Replacing a BMW key fob includes numerous actions. Here's a breakdown of the procedure:
Step 1: Determine the Type of Key Fob
Identify the kind of key fob you need for your specific BMW New Key design, as Replacement Key BMW treatments and expenses typically vary. Examine your owner's manual or contact a BMW dealer for assistance.
Action 2: Gather Necessary Documentation
When you approach a dealership or locksmith, you'll need to provide particular documentation, consisting of:
Proof of ownership (automobile title, registration, or insurance card)Personal recognition (driver's license or passport)VIN (Vehicle Identification Number)Step 3: Choose a Replacement Option
You have several options for key fob Replacement BMW Key Fob. These consist of:
Authorized BMW Dealer: Offers O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ts, guaranteeing compatibility and quality. However, this is frequently the most costly alternative.Automotive Locksmith: Typically a more budget-friendly choice, supplying the convenience of pertaining to you, though they may use aftermarket parts.Online Retailers: Purchasing a key fob online can conserve money, but you must have it configured, which might need expert help.Step 4: Programming the Key Fob
After acquiring your new key fob, programming is essential. This procedure varies based on the fob type and model year, however it can generally be done at a dealership or by a certified locksmith. Here's what to expect:
For Smart and Display Key Fobs: Requires specialized devices to sync with the lorry.For Traditional Key Fobs: May include a simpler reprogramming process that can in some cases be carried out by the owner.Step 5: Testing the New Key Fob
As soon as set, check the key fob thoroughly to guarantee it's operating properly, inspecting features such as locking, opening, and beginning the lorry.
Costs of Replacement
The rate of a BMW key fob replacement can vary significantly based upon numerous factors, including:
Key Fob Type: Smart and display key fobs are usually more pricey than conventional ones.Dealer vs. Locksmith: Going through an authorized dealership generally incurs higher expenses.Setting Fees: This might be included in the cost when bought from a dealer however can come as a surcharge from a locksmith.
Here's a general breakdown of replacement costs:
Replacement OptionEstimated Cost RangeLicensed Dealer₤ 300 - ₤ 600Automotive Locksmith₤ 100 - ₤ 400Online Purchases₤ 50 - ₤ 250 (plus programs)FAQs about BMW Key Fob ReplacementThe length of time does it take to replace a BMW key fob?
The replacement procedure normally takes anywhere from 30 minutes to a few hours, depending on the approach picked and whether programs is required.
Can I recycle my old key fob?
If your key fob is merely lost or harmed and still functional in regards to programming, you might be able to have it fixed or reprogrammed, which can conserve costs.
Will my lorry's features be affected by a new key fob?
All functions related to the initial key fob ought to be replicated in the new key fob, supplied it is properly set and compatible.
What should I do if my key fob is malfunctioning?
If your key fob is malfunctioning even after a replacement, it may show a problem with the vehicle's receiver or battery. It is recommended to check out a dealer or certified locksmith for diagnosis.
